    Does Kokoro have MSG in any of its food?

    Hi Casey! No! We do not add MSG to anything. We try to also source top ingredients. From local produce, to USDA Choice Beef, to Red Bird (no antibiotic, never frozen) chicken. We also cut and prep all of our vegetables by hand.
